PRE-DRAFT AWARDS AND HONORS
Miscellaneous: Attended Athol Murray College of Notre Dame in Wilcox,
Saskatchewan, before entering major junior hockey. |
| NHL CAREER |
| Never played in NHL. |
| NON-NHL CAREER |
Post-Draft Teams: Portland, Spokane (WHL);
Fredericton (AHL); Muskegon (IHL); Baltimore (AHL); Team Canada NON-NHL
AWARDS AND HONORS BCAHA Coach of Year: 2000-01 (Campbell
River)
WHL West All-Star Second Team: 1985-86 (Spokane)
Coaching Career: Named Powell River (BCJHL) head coach prior to
2001-02 season and remained in position through 2004-05 season.
Management Career: Named Powell River (BCJHL) general manager prior to
2001-02 season and held position through 2004-05 season.
Miscellaneous: Coached minor hockey in his hometown of Campbell
River, B.C., following his retirement. ... Coached Team Pacific in 2001
World Under-17 Hockey Challenge in Nova Scotia. |
